[Exchange 2007] Kan de e-mailadres policy niet wijzigen

Pagina: 1
Acties:

  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Hallo allemaal,

Onder Hub transport van Organization Congifuration wil ik de e-mailaddress policy bekijken/wijzigen, maar dan krijg ik een foutmelding zoals op de foto aangegeven:


Afbeeldingslocatie: http://img14.imageshack.us/img14/4840/exchangeerror.th.jpg

Ik vraag mij af waar deze error vandaan komt. Een paar weken geleden heb ik wel Update Rollup 6 geïnstalleerd.

Alle suggesties zijn welkom.

Alvast bedankt.

Mvg

@ Mods ( Titel is niet compleet, Zou je dat willen aanpassen naar [Exchange 2007] kan de e-mailadres policie niet wijzigen)

[ Voor 14% gewijzigd door lawkexarib op 05-01-2010 12:42 ]


  • sanfranjake
  • Registratie: April 2003
  • Niet online

sanfranjake

Computers can do that?

(overleden)
Allereerst zou ik je willen adviseren om Exchange 2007 Service Pack 2 te installeren, of als je een goede reden weet om dat niet te doen minimaal rollup 9 voor SP1.

Maar sowieso voor dit probleem geen oplossing denk ik. Het lijkt er namelijk op dat je een transitie hebt uitgevoerd van Exchange 2000 of 2003. Deze gegevens worden in een ander formaat opgeslagen en daarom heb je geen toegang.
Als je oude Exchangeserver nog bestaat kan je daar de policies editten, of met het genoemde powershell commando de gegevens upgraden naar Exchange 2007.
Er zijn overigens nog veel meer zaken zoals distributiegroepen die geupgrade moeten worden.

Mijn spoorwegfotografie
Somda - Voor en door treinenspotters


Verwijderd

Titel aangepast op verzoek.Verder was dit de eerste hit op Google toen ik op die foutmelding zocht:
http://msexchangeteam.com/archive/2007/01/11/432158.aspx

ExBPA zou je ook nog meer informatie moeten geven trouwens.

  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Hallo sanfranjake,

Bedankt voor jouw reactie. We hebben idd nog een exchange 2003 server naast twee virtuele exchange servers 2007. Deze exchange 2003 is dus nog functioneel, maar het liefste wil ik deze z.s.m. uitfaseren. Echter, met exchange 2003 heb ik 0.0 ervaring.

Momenteel ben ik bezig met cursus 70-236 (exchange 2007). Het bevalt mij wel en leer erg veel over exchange 2007.

Heb even gekeken naar welke SP en rollups zijn bij ons geinstalleerd:

Aparte virtuele server (Exchange 2007): MAIL01,Update Rollup 9 for Exchange Server 2007 Service Pack 1 (KB970162) 8.1.393.1,2009/09/13,08.01.0393.001

Aparte virtuele server (Exchange 2007)TS01,Update Rollup 6 for Exchange Server 2007 Service Pack 1 (KB959241) 8.1.340.1,2009/12/21,08.01.0340.001

Heb je overigens een tutorial die stap voor stap uitlegt hoe jij een omgeving van exchange 2003 volledig uitfaseert naar exchange 2007?

Alvast bedankt.

  • jeroenvdnberg
  • Registratie: Juni 2005
  • Laatst online: 29-01 14:08
lawkexarib schreef op dinsdag 05 januari 2010 @ 14:25:
Heb je overigens een tutorial die stap voor stap uitlegt hoe jij een omgeving van exchange 2003 volledig uitfaseert naar exchange 2007?
Misschien heb je hier iets aan?
Klik
Klik
Klik

[ Voor 51% gewijzigd door jeroenvdnberg op 05-01-2010 14:34 ]


  • KorneelB
  • Registratie: Mei 2008
  • Laatst online: 31-12-2025
trek eerst eens die update rollups samen. je mag niet voor langere tijd verschillende patchlevels binnen exchange draaien, dit gaat voor problemen zorgen. verschillende patchlevels zijn alleen gebruikelijk tijdens een upgrade proces.

verder:
je gebruikt waarschijnlijk LDAP queries (dat was normaal in exchange 2003). wat je hoort te doen is in je exchange 2003 omgeving je oude LDAP filters te upgraden naar de nieuwe OPATH filters.

meer info:

http://blogs.technet.com/...ail-address-policies.aspx

makkelijkste is een nieuwe te maken, daarna de oude weg te gooien.

60 TB can not be enough


  • Jazzy
  • Registratie: Juni 2000
  • Laatst online: 15:01

Jazzy

Moderator SSC/PB

Moooooh!

Goed bedoeld maar ik zou toch adviseren om de officiële TechNet documentatie te gebruiken. Zo'n blog of howto is nooit exact het scenario wat jij zelf hebt en werkt dan alleen maar verwarrend. Zie voor meer informatie: http://technet.microsoft....y/bb288905(EXCHG.80).aspx

Exchange en Office 365 specialist. Mijn blog.


  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Hallo allemaal,

Bedankt voor jullie reacties tot zover. De aangedragen links zijn zeker waardevol om ernaar te kijken. Echter, ik wil beginnen met het transaction process, nadat ik de cursus 70-236 af heb. Mocht er iets niet goed gaan, dan heb ik meer kennis in huis en dan weet ik waar ik het over heb.

Overigens, op TS01 (CAS) heb ik Rollup v. 9 geïnstalleerd. De installatie gaf verder geen problemen, maar wanneer ik de status bekijk via een PS script, dan krijg ik twee versies te zijn:

Server Name,Rollup Update Description,Installed Date,ExSetup File Version
MAIL01,Update Rollup 9 for Exchange Server 2007 Service Pack 1 (KB970162) 8.1.393.1,2009/09/13,08.01.0393.001
TS01,Update Rollup 6 for Exchange Server 2007 Service Pack 1 (KB959241) 8.1.340.1,2009/12/21,08.01.0393.001
TS01,Update Rollup 9 for Exchange Server 2007 Service Pack 1 (KB970162) 8.1.393.1,2010/01/05,08.01.0393.001

Iemand enig idee hoe dit kan?

Alvast bedankt.

  • Jazzy
  • Registratie: Juni 2000
  • Laatst online: 15:01

Jazzy

Moderator SSC/PB

Moooooh!

Dat is een beetje gissen als wij niet weten welk script je draait. Daar zal vast een foutje in zitten.

Goed idee trouwens om de transitie af te maken als je 70-236 gedaan hebt.

Exchange en Office 365 specialist. Mijn blog.


  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Hallo Jazzy,

Onderstaande script heb ik gebruikt. Deze script heb ik via Google gevonden.

code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
# Store header in variable
$headerLine = 
@"
 
Server Name,Rollup Update Description,Installed Date,ExSetup File Version
"@
 
# Write header to file
$headerLine | Out-File .\results.csv -Encoding ASCII -Append
 
function getRU()
{
# Set server to connect to
    $Server = "$_".ToUpper()
 
 
# Check if server is running Exchange 2007 or Exchange 2010
 
    $ExchVer = (Get-ExchangeServer $Server | ForEach {$_.AdminDisplayVersion.Major})
 
# Set appropriate base path to read Registry
# Exit function if server is not running Exchange 2007 or Exchange 2010
    if ($ExchVer -eq "8" -or $ExchVer -eq "14")
        {
            switch ($ExchVer)
            {
             "14"   {
                        $REG_KEY = "SOFTWARE\\Microsoft\\Windows\\CurrentVersion\\Installer\\UserData\\S-1-5-18\\Products\\AE1D439464EB1B8488741FFA028E291C\\Patches"
                        $Reg_ExSetup = "SOFTWARE\\Microsoft\\ExchangeServer\\v14\\Setup"
                    }
             "8"    {
                        $REG_KEY = "SOFTWARE\\Microsoft\\Windows\\CurrentVersion\\Installer\\UserData\\S-1-5-18\\Products\\461C2B4266EDEF444B864AD6D9E5B613\\Patches"
                        $Reg_ExSetup = "SOFTWARE\\Microsoft\\Exchange\\Setup"
                    }
            }
        } 
    else
        {return}
 
# Read Rollup Update information from servers
 
# Set Registry constants
    $VALUE1 = "DisplayName"
    $VALUE2 = "Installed"
    $VALUE3 = "MsiInstallPath"
 
# Open remote registry
    $reg = [Microsoft.Win32.RegistryKey]::OpenRemoteBaseKey('LocalMachine', $Server)
 
# Set regKey for MsiInstallPath
    $regKey= $reg.OpenSubKey($REG_ExSetup)
 
# Get Install Path from Registry and replace : with $
    $installPath = ($regkey.getvalue($VALUE3) | foreach {$_ -replace (":","`$")})
 
# Set ExSetup.exe path
    $binFile = "Bin\ExSetup.exe"
 
# Get ExSetup.exe file version
    $exSetupVer = ((Get-Command "\\$Server\$installPath$binFile").FileVersionInfo | ForEach {$_.FileVersion})
 
# Create an array of patch subkeys
    $regKey= $reg.OpenSubKey($REG_KEY).GetSubKeyNames() | ForEach {"$Reg_Key\\$_"}
 
# Walk through patch subkeys and store Rollup Update Description and Installed Date in array variables
    $dispName = [array] ($regkey | %{$reg.OpenSubKey($_).getvalue($VALUE1)})
    $instDate = [array] ($regkey | %{$reg.OpenSubKey($_).getvalue($VALUE2)})
 
# Loop Through array variables and output to a file
    $countmembers = 0
 
    if ($regkey -ne $null)


Mvg

  • Qwerty-273
  • Registratie: Oktober 2001
  • Laatst online: 28-01 23:19

Qwerty-273

Meukposter

***** ***

Dan heb je waarschijnlijk op TS01 rollup 9 SP1 geinstalleerd zonder eerst rollup 6 SP1 te verwijderen....
Je script checkt de entries in de registry van de bepaalde server waar nu dus twee patches vermeld worden.

Erzsébet Bathory | Strajk Kobiet | You can lose hope in leaders, but never lose hope in the future.


Verwijderd

Maar je hoeft eerdere rollups niet te verwijderen om een nieuwe te installeren, dus het lijkt me gewoon aan dat script te liggen.

  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Hallo Qwerty-273,

Ik heb idd de RU 9 gedownload en geïnstalleerd vanaf exchange download site. Weliswaar niet via de Windows update, maar gewoon hard.
Op Mail01 (Mailbox, HUB) heb ik RU 9 via Windows update geïnstalleerd.

Moet ik nu alsnog de RU6 verwijderen van TS01 (CAS)? Zojah, heeft dit gevolgen voor de omgeving of niet?

Ik hoor graag

Mvg

  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Verwijderd schreef op woensdag 06 januari 2010 @ 11:42:
Maar je hoeft eerdere rollups niet te verwijderen om een nieuwe te installeren, dus het lijkt me gewoon aan dat script te liggen.
Dit lijkt mij ook logisch, want in RU 6 zaten er ook bepaalde fixs neem ik aan...

Verwijderd

Rollups zijn cumulatief, dus alle fixes die in eerdere rollups zitten, zullen ook in de laatste zitten. Maar je kan gewoon rollup 9 installeren zonder rollup 6 te deinstalleren.

  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
Heb ik nu een probleem dat twee registerkeys zijn die verschillend zijn? Dus eentje geeft aan dat het om RU 6 gaat en die andere om RU9?

  • KorneelB
  • Registratie: Mei 2008
  • Laatst online: 31-12-2025
nee, zijn cumulatief.

waarschijnlijk heb je op de ene meteen rollup 9 geinstalleerd, en op de andere, eerst 6, daarna 9. geen probleem, je ziet het alleen. verder maakt het voor de werking niks uit.

60 TB can not be enough


  • lawkexarib
  • Registratie: Maart 2009
  • Laatst online: 28-11-2025
@ freak1,

Bedankt voor jouw feedback. Dat is iig een last minder op mijn schouders :)
Pagina: 1